Pöyry extensively involved in designing the Helsinki City Rail Loop

Pöyry has received several assignments concerning the engineering of the Helsinki City Rail Loop. The Helsinki City Rail Loop is a commuter rail loop planned to be built underneath the centre of Helsinki.

Pöyry will perform bedrock surveys on the Loop within a consortium on the eastern, Hakaniemi side. Pöyry is also responsible for rock construction and geological planning in the Töölö area.

In June, Pöyry won the design competition for the Vauhtitie underpass bridge and its surroundings, to design the bridge, the opening of the nearby railway tunnel, and the road arrangements of the Vauhtitie area. Pöyry's proposal, "Chicaner", was the unanimous choice of the jury, and it also won the public vote. As a result, Pöyry was assigned the comprehensive design of the Vauhtitie area. In addition to designing the bridge, the assignment includes designing the road, environment, geological and water maintenance, and traffic.

Pöyry's water maintenance network designers will design the pipe and cable transfers required by the City Rail Loop. Pöyry architects are also involved in the design of the Hakaniemi station and its road tunnels.

The Helsinki City Rail Loop is a widely challenging project as it is designed in an urban built environment. Pöyry has the experience and capabilities to carry out all assignments.

All design in the City Rail Loop project is based on information modelling. The designing implemented now will act as the basis for the Parliament's future decision on implementing the project.

Pöyry is also responsible for the City Rail Loop's risk management expert service in the track and construction engineering phases. Risk management improves project safety by anticipating the project's hazards and risks related to designing, construction, introduction and use.

The total value of the above assignments is EUR 4.7 million. The order was recognised in the Regional Operations business stock in Q4.

The Helsinki City Loop is a project (currently at the planning stage) run by the Finnish Transport Agency and the City of Helsinki. The loop-shaped track will serve the local traffic in the capital region. It is designed to travel from Pasila through a tunnel underneath Töölö, Helsinki city centre and Hakaniemi, returning to Pasila. The Loop will help make the entire rail system of Finland run more smoothly.

The Finnish Parliament will make the final decision on building the City Rail Loop. After the decision, more detailed planning will commence. If the decision is made in 2014, the excavation of railway tunnels and stations can commence in the city centre in 2015 or 2016. The estimated total cost of the project is €740 million.
